Chipotle Cheese Rice

Be the first to rate this recipe

Ingredients

  • 2-1/2 cups Water
  • 1 cup Brown Rice (I Used Mahatma Brand)
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 2 whole Chipotle Peppers In Adobo
  • 3/4 cups Grated Cheese (pepper Jack Or Other)

Instructions

  1. Bring the water to a boil in a small pot. Add the rice and salt. Reduce heat to low and cover to simmer for 40 minutes.
  2. Chop up the chipotle peppers and add it to the rice anytime during cooking.
  3. Keep an eye on the rice starting at about 35 minutes to make sure that it doesn't burn if it's done prematurely. When you've confirmed that it is nice and tender, stir in the cheese of your choice. I also added cayenne pepper, which is great if you're really looking for spiciness, but probably intolerable for most households.
  4. Tastes great when served with slices of fresh avacado!
  5. (This may serve more than 3, but I am assuming you really like it and want to eat a lot.)
